A retaining wall adds to the landscape’s aesthetic appeal while holding back soil and water, and keeping sloping grounds in naturally impossible positions. Some of the considerations one needs to make when building a retaining wall include:

Material
Select suitable materials that are locally available and will take a shorter time during transportation. Utilizing locally available materials is an essential consideration as it ensures the building process is smooth and done to completion. Retaining walls get used for anchorage; it is thus crucial that its building process is seen to completion as midway stops due to lack of materials may lead to a collapse of the wall. The materials should also be of good quality to enhance the wall’s durability.

Weight of structure
If the retaining wall gets built to give anchorage to a building or shifting area, ensure the retaining wall’s design can hold the structure’s weight. Come up with a plan that is proportionate to the frame’s weight to ensure the retaining wall adequately serves its purpose.

Budget
Ensure one correctly calculates the cost of building a retaining wall to prevent over-quoting or under-quoting. The builders need to decide whether the retaining wall is concrete or dry-laid and then put in other expenses such as excavation to ensure they come up with the correct amount to finish the project successfully.

Concrete walls are more structurally stable, while the dry-laid design is easier to install and less costly. Depending on the retaining wall’s functionality, one can utilize such differences to decide which one is appropriate for the project.

Soil bearing pressure
When building a wall, consider the soil bearing pressure to ensure the wall does not collapse. The builders can include weeping holes on the wall to eliminate water build-up, promoting increased pressure that weakens the walls. Strategically place the wall to ensure it can hold the pressure of the soil and water.

Foundation
A retaining wall’s foundation is vital for ensuring it can withstand other materials’ pressure, weight, and external factors like water and wind. A well-built foundation enables a retaining wall to anchor well and promotes its effectiveness. Ensure the foundation gets built to allow water flow if near a water body and continual hydration of plants to prevent weakening.

Construction of retaining walls should consider functionality and aesthetics. This act ensures a retaining wall fits seamlessly into the overall landscape design.
